Key Features of a Successful Sports App

When you are ready to build a sports app, understanding the key features that can make your app successful is paramount. Here are essential features that you should consider:

1. Live Score Updates

Providing live score updates is fundamental for any sports app. Users not only want to know the scores but also to keep track of the game developments. This feature should be user-friendly and cover multiple sports.

2. News and Articles

Keeping your users informed with the latest news articles, interviews, and other content related to their favorite sports can create a loyal user base. Curating content from various reliable sources is critical.

3. Notifications

Offering customizable notifications can keep users engaged. They can choose to receive alerts about their favorite teams, player injuries, or any breaking news.

4. Social Media Integration

Incorporating social media sharing options allows users to engage with content actively and share their opinions, further increasing app visibility.

5. Interactive Features

  • Fantasy League: Allow users to create their fantasy teams and track their performance over the season.
  • Polls and Quizzes: Engaging users with polls or quizzes promotes interaction within the app.

Steps to Build Your Sports App

Once you have a clear understanding of the market and key features, the next step is to build your sports app. Follow these systematic steps:

Step 1: Conduct Market Research

Before starting the development process, it's vital to conduct extensive market research. Identify your target audience, study your competitors, and gather insights on user preferences. Use tools like surveys and focus groups to get firsthand feedback.

Step 2: Define Your App's Purpose and Features

Clearly define what you want your app to achieve. Write a detailed list of features you wish to implement based on the gathered research. This outline will guide your developers throughout the process.

Step 3: Choose the Right Technology Stack

Choosing the right technology stack is crucial for your app's performance and scalability. Depending on your target audience, you might choose to develop a native app for iOS, Android, or a cross-platform solution. Some popular frameworks are:

  • React Native
  • Flutter
  • Swift for iOS
  • Kotlin for Android

Step 4: Wireframing and Prototyping

Create wireframes and prototypes to visualize your app structure. This step helps in refining user experience (UX) and making necessary adjustments before actual development.

Step 5: Development and Testing

The development phase is where your app comes to life. Ensure rigorous testing is conducted throughout the process to identify and resolve any issues, improve performance, and ensure a smooth user experience.

Step 6: Launch and Marketing

Once your app is tested and ready, it's time to launch it on the App Store and Google Play Store. An effective marketing strategy is essential to promote your newly built sports app. Consider the following strategies:

  • App Store Optimization (ASO): Optimize your app listing with relevant keywords and engaging descriptions.
  • Social Media Marketing: Utilize platforms like Instagram, Twitter, and Facebook to reach sports enthusiasts.
  • Influencer Marketing: Collaborate with sports influencers to gain credibility and visibility.

Monetization Strategies for Sports Apps

As you venture into creating your sports app, understanding how to monetize it is essential for your business success. Here are some effective monetization strategies:

1. Freemium Model

Offer basic features for free while charging for premium features. This model helps attract a larger user base and convert free users into paying customers over time.

2. In-App Advertising

Integrate ad services within your app. You can partner with advertising networks like Google AdMob or other sports-related brands.

3. Sponsorship and Partnerships

Collaborate with brands for sponsorships that can bring extra revenue. Consider partnerships with local teams or leagues that can benefit from exposure through your app.

4. Subscription Model

Offer users a subscription for exclusive content, features, or ad-free experiences. This model provides a steady revenue stream.
